Mars in Virgo: The Psychology of the Perfectionist and Analytical Mind

Mars in Virgo: The Psychology of the Perfectionist and Analytical Mind

Mars in Virgo is not about brute force or impulsive action. It is energy directed toward improvement, analysis, and service. Psychologically, this placement creates a cognitive style based on detail orientation, critical thinking, and a need for order. Unlike Mars in Aries, which acts spontaneously, Mars in Virgo analyzes, plans, and then acts, often double-checking itself.

Core Traits and Behavioral Patterns

Individuals with Mars in Virgo possess high levels of self-control and discipline. Their motivation often stems from a desire to be useful and efficient. They are prone to perfectionism, which can be both a resource and a source of stress. Behaviorally, this manifests in:

  • A preference for routine and order. Chaos triggers anxiety, so they structure their time and space.
  • Critical thinking. They notice errors and inconsistencies that others miss. This makes them excellent editors, analysts, and diagnosticians.
  • Restrained anger expression. Anger is rarely explosive. Instead, it may be expressed through passive-aggression, sarcasm, or excessive criticism.
  • A need for control. Control over details provides a sense of security.
  • Emotional Needs and Triggers

    The primary emotional need is a sense of competence. They need to know they are doing their job well. A key trigger for stress is inefficiency, disorder, and criticism of their work. From an attachment theory perspective, Mars in Virgo can foster a preoccupied or avoidant style, where closeness is achieved through caregiving and task completion, rather than emotional vulnerability.

    Relationships

    In relationships, Mars in Virgo shows love through actions, not words. They are caring, practical, and reliable. However, their tendency to criticize can wound a partner. Psychologically, they need to learn to accept imperfection in others. They seek a partner who values their contributions and does not demand emotional drama.

    How to Work with This Energy

    To make Mars in Virgo energy constructive rather than destructive, it is important to:

    1. Direct perfectionism toward the process, not just the outcome. Mistakes are part of learning. 2. Use the analytical mind for problem-solving, not self-criticism. 3. Practice mindfulness to notice when control turns into anxiety. 4. Express anger directly but constructively.

    Mars in Virgo is the energy of service and mastery. When a person with this placement finds balance between the drive for perfection and acceptance of the world's imperfection, they become an indispensable specialist and a reliable partner.
